Real-time PCR Thermal Cyclers Market Size

The global market for Real-time PCR Thermal Cyclers was valued at US$ 3198 million in the year 2024 and is projected to reach a revised size of US$ 5031 million by 2031, growing at a CAGR of 6.8% during the forecast period.

Real-time PCR thermal cyclers, also known as quantitative PCR (qPCR) machines, are specialized laboratory instruments used to amplify and simultaneously quantify DNA or RNA in real-time. Unlike traditional PCR, which only allows for end-point detection, real-time PCR monitors the amplification process as it occurs, using fluorescent dyes or probes to measure nucleic acid concentration in each cycle. This approach provides both qualitative and quantitative data on the genetic material present in a sample.
In 2024, global production of real-time PCR thermal cyclers will be approximately 76,500 units, with an average selling price of US$41,800 per unit.
Regional Market Structure
North America and Europe together account for over half of the global market share, with North America leading the way, driven primarily by technological upgrades (such as six-color fluorescence detection) and high-end scientific research needs.
The Asia-Pacific region saw the fastest growth. Surging demand for primary healthcare development and infectious disease testing in China, India, and Southeast Asia has driven a year-on-year surge in domestic equipment imports. Strong demand for domestically produced mid- and low-end equipment in the Middle East and Latin America is expected to drive imports in 2024, with countries like Egypt and Turkey driving market expansion through government procurement.
Growth Drivers
Policy and Industry Support
China's policy regulations: The implementation of standards such as the "Guidelines for Performance Evaluation of Digital PCR Equipment" requires a deviation rate of ≤12%, forcing manufacturers to increase calibration costs. The average price of equipment is expected to rise slightly after 2026.
Accelerating domestic substitution: Companies such as Daan Gene and Shengxiang Biotechnology have driven domestic equipment prices to over 60% lower than imported ones through an integrated "equipment + reagent" strategy. Growing demand in research and clinical settings
Oncology companion diagnostics: Applications such as EGFR testing for lung cancer and KRAS mutation analysis for colorectal cancer are driving the penetration of qPCR in precision oncology medicine.
Agriculture and food safety: Demand for genetically modified crop testing and foodborne pathogen screening is driving an increase in the share of qPCR in non-medical applications.
Future Trends and Forecasts
Models supporting 36 or more channels will become mainstream. Fully automated qPCR systems, by integrating sample loading and plate sealing functions, will increase daily testing throughput, driving demand for equipment.
The replacement rate of digital PCR (dPCR) for qPCR will increase, but qPCR will still dominate routine testing.

Competitive Landscape and Leading Manufacturers
Global Market Concentration
Thermo Fisher Scientific, Roche, and Bio-Rad dominate the global high-end equipment market. Chinese manufacturers such as Daan Gene and Shengxiang Biotechnology are increasing their market share through an integrated "equipment + reagent" strategy.
Risks and Challenges
dPCR's advantages in high-sensitivity detection (such as ctDNA quantification) may divert demand from the qPCR market.
The popularity of next-generation sequencing (NGS) in genomic analysis may squeeze qPCR's share in the scientific research market.
The domestic production rate of PCR raw materials (such as Taq enzyme and probes) is only 25%. Companies such as Feipeng Biotechnology and Novozymes are driving cost reductions through enzyme-directed mutagenesis technology, but they still need to overcome barriers to entry for high-end raw materials.
